Additional information

This paper reports a new design tool for inscribing nano/micro photonics structures, developed under the collaboration between Aston Institute of Photonic Technologies and the Cyprus University of Technology. The joint work set the base for further collaboration under two FP7 Marie Curie International Incoming Fellowship projects (MIDFIL: €200.4k, 2012-2014 and SOFST: €231.3k, 2013-2015). Subsequent work has resulted in two more papers published in peer-reviewed journals (DOI: 10.1109/JLT.2011.2175702; DOI: 10.1109/RADECS.2011.6131460) and seven presentations at international conferences. The design principle and developed tool will facilitate new lasers and sensors in novel fibres covering wavelengths from visible to mid-IR.
